Output daf03cbdc862faefc5c914b18d7c2d8b24243869e89d55a60ae5268c1a1b6bc1:29

value
434000
script pubkey
OP_0 OP_PUSHBYTES_20 bf976332833e435ba11abba9d2042e25aa19ee1c
address
bc1qh7tkxv5r8ep4hgg6hw5ayppwyk4pnmsuxcqm2w
transaction
daf03cbdc862faefc5c914b18d7c2d8b24243869e89d55a60ae5268c1a1b6bc1
spent
true